Jerry Leon Carroll age 84 of Baker passed away on Saturday, August 3rd, 2019 surrounded by his family. He was born in Andalusia, AL on December 13, 1934 to Clyde and Opal Carroll. Jerry left home at an early age and entered the United States Navy. He worked as a Hospital Corpsman and reached the rank of Master Chief. After serving in many different ports he retired with 23 years of service. Jerry then went to work at North Okaloosa Medical Center where he worked as Radiology Director for 13 years before retiring. Jerry loved his family and he dedicated his life to the Masons and Shriners serving for many years. He was the past Potentate of the Hadji Shrine in 2002 and past Master of Mt. Ewell Lodge in Baker. Jerry was also a dual member of Concord Masonic Lodge in Crestview. He was preceded in death by his parents and brothers: Madison, Clydie and Charles Carroll.
